The coronavirus pandemic in Nigeria is still spreading most especially in Lagos according to recent reports, the Nigerian Centre for Disease Control (NCDC) today released reports of new cases in only Lagos state.

The new report came about two hours after they had initially reported 19 new cases in the country. The agency made this news in a tweet;

Itsaid, ” Eleven new cases of #COVID19 have been reported in Lagos State. As at 11:00 pm 14th April there are 373 confirmed cases of #COVID19 reported in Nigeria. 99 have been discharged with 11 deaths.”

This brings the number of active coronavirus cases in the country to 263. The cases by states is; Lagos- 214, FCT- 58, Osun- 20, Edo- 15, Oyo- 11, Ogun- 9, Bauchi- 6, Kaduna- 6, Akwa Ibom- 6, Katsina-5, Kwara- 4, Kano- 4, Ondo- 3, Delta- 3, Enugu- 2, Ekiti- 2, Rivers-2, Benue- 1, Niger- 1, Anambra- 1.
